Leaking is most likely to happen in the morning (when milk supply is at its peak) and during feedings (when one side leaks while a baby is nursing from the other side). Understanding why breast milk leaks leaking breast milk is a natural part of lactation It happens because the milk ducts and alveoli in the breasts are actively producing and storing milk The hormone prolactin signals milk production, while oxytocin triggers milk ejection or letdown
When the breasts become full or stimulated—by a baby's suckling, a reflex, or even a sound or thought. Leaking should improve as your body adjusts to breastfeeding
But until your breasts become adept at the art of releasing milk from the ducts at precisely the right time (i.e
When baby is at the breast), letdown and the subsequent leak could occur at any time, without warning. In the first few weeks, your letdown reflex is still getting used to the breastfeeding rhythm and adjusting to its milk supply Until it's fully found its feet, you may experience leaking when you're not even breastfeeding. Hormonal changes during pregnancy and after childbirth, hormonal fluctuations are a natural part of the process Prolactin is a hormone that stimulates milk production, while oxytocin helps with milk ejection during breastfeeding.
